Experience
Victoria Covelli is a Mental Health Counselor with an Advanced Certificate from the New York Institute of Technology and a background as a certified school counselor.
Her experience working in school settings gives her a unique understanding of the academic, social, and emotional pressures that children and teens face. She transitioned into clinical mental health counseling to provide more in-depth, individualized support to clients and families.
Victoria has experience working with children, teens, and adults across a range of settings, supporting individuals through emotional, behavioral, and relational challenges.
